Iñigo Dominic Lazaro Pascual (born September 14, 1997) is a talented Filipino actor, singer, and songwriter. He is well-known for his popular song "Dahil Sa'yo" from 2016. This song was the first to reach number one on the Billboard Philippines Philippine Top 20 chart. It also won "Song of the Year" at the 30th Awit Awards. Iñigo is the son of famous actor Piolo Pascual.

Early Life and Moving to the Philippines

Iñigo Dominic Lazaro Pascual was born on September 14, 1997, in the Philippines. His father is actor Piolo Pascual. When Iñigo was 8 years old, he moved to the United States with his mother. Later, at age 17, he decided to move back to the Philippines. He wanted to start his career in the entertainment industry there.

Iñigo's Career Journey

Starting Out in Film (2014–2015)

Iñigo Pascual got his first main role in a movie in 2014. It was a teen romance film called Relaks, It's Just Pag-ibig. In the movie, he played Josh Brillantes. Josh was a teenage boy who helped a girl find a pair of lovers during a special blue moon. Iñigo's father, Piolo Pascual, also appeared in the film.

In 2015, Iñigo starred in another teen romance movie, Para sa Hopeless Romantic. He acted alongside James Reid, Nadine Lustre, and Julia Barretto. He played Ryan Sebastian, a character from a story written by one of the main characters. After this, Iñigo was in Crazy Beautiful You. He played Marcus Alcantara, who was the stepbrother of Daniel Padilla's character. Marcus had feelings for Kathryn Bernardo's character in the film.

Iñigo also appeared in TV shows like Maalaala Mo Kaya and Wansapanataym. He then got a role in the drama series And I Love You So. He played Justin Santiago, a character who was a love interest for two other characters in the show.

Music Success and International Steps (2016–2018)

In 2016, Iñigo Pascual released his first album, titled Iñigo Pascual. It was released under Star Music. This album included his big hit song, "Dahil Sa'Yo." This song made history as the first number one track on the Billboard Philippines Top 20 chart.

In 2017, Disney Philippines chose Iñigo to sing the Philippine version of "Remember Me." This was the main song from the Disney-Pixar animated movie, Coco. In 2019, Iñigo released his first international solo song, "Options." This song was produced by Bernard "HARV" Harvey, a music producer from Los Angeles.

During the COVID-19 pandemic in May 2020, Iñigo was part of 88rising's online music festival called Asia Rising Forever. He performed a cover of Post Malone's song "Better Now." In June 2020, Iñigo also performed as a musical guest in Filipino-American comedian Jo Koy's Netflix special, Jo Koy: In His Elements.

American TV Debut

On September 15, 2021, it was announced that Iñigo Pascual joined the cast of the Fox drama series Monarch. This was his first time acting on American television.

Life in Los Angeles

Iñigo Pascual currently lives in Los Angeles, California, United States. In January 2025, he and his family had to leave their home because of wildfires in California.
